Output 28c7ea87613ed630fb82b060e687bbcb25445283072fa4336b6d17e266bf047d:1

value
2321326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e7fe0a88c3b3dc33374a47dd1703bab6e9e91ab OP_EQUAL
address
3G95swcYaajUHH6G5R1GDdJFwfkNtWef84
transaction
28c7ea87613ed630fb82b060e687bbcb25445283072fa4336b6d17e266bf047d
spent
true